Definition

  1. 1
    Enteramente, en toda su extensión, desde el principio hasta el fin. Se dice de explicaciones, relatos o saberes.
  2. 2
    Claramente, de manera fácil de comprender u obvia.

Recorded use

Wiktionary examples

These source excerpts show how de pe a pa appears in context. They illustrate usage; the definition above remains the entry’s reference meaning.

  1. Ella tiene sus reglas para todo, y tu, que has vivido en Santiago, debes entenderlas mejor que yo. Pero si no las entiendes, ella te las esplicará de pe a pa
  2. Cuando Correas enseñó que de pe-a pa (pues asf se debiera escribir) significa decir las cosas claras, pregonó una verdad de Perogrullo …. Cosas de pe-a pa, son cosas claras; razón de pe-a pa, es razón evidente; negocio de pe-a pa, es negocio manifiesto; oficio de pe-a pa, es oficio que todo el mundo sabe hacer; ley de pe-a pa, es ley obvia á todos.
